Air Filtration Efficiency
Efficient air filtering is basic for maintaining high indoor air top quality, as air-borne particles can significantly influence health and convenience. Heating and cooling systems make use of various filters to record dust, plant pollen, family pet dander, and various other contaminants, considerably minimizing the focus of these irritants airborne. High-efficiency particle air (HEPA) filters, as an example, are designed to trap at the very least 99.97% of fragments that are 0.3 microns or larger, making them highly efficient for allergy victims and people with respiratory problems. Routine upkeep and timely substitute of filters are important to guarantee peak filtration performance. By improving air purification performance, HVAC systems play an important function in advertising a much healthier living environment, inevitably contributing to the overall well-being of residents in modern-day homes and buildings.
Moisture Control Conveniences
Keeping ideal moisture levels within interior atmospheres considerably enhances air top quality and overall convenience. Proper moisture control contributes to the decrease of airborne toxins and irritants, such as allergen and mold and mildew spores, which flourish in excessively humid conditions. On the other hand, low moisture can result in completely dry skin, respiratory system problems, and boosted vulnerability to diseases. An a/c system furnished with moisture control features can maintain ideal dampness levels, making sure a balanced setting. This not only advertises health but likewise safeguards building products and furnishings from damage triggered by changes in moisture. Power Efficiency Innovations
What ingenious options are arising to improve energy efficiency in HVAC systems? The integration of innovative modern technologies plays an essential role in maximizing power consumption. Variable cooling agent circulation (VRF) systems enable precise control of heating & cooling, adjusting to real-time demands. Clever thermostats use device knowing formulas to anticipate user actions, consequently reducing power waste. An additional pattern includes the adoption of energy recovery ventilators, which recover warm from exhaust air, significantly lowering the power needed for home heating or cooling down incoming air. Furthermore, the development of improved insulation materials and high-efficiency heatpump contributes to reducing overall power consumption. These technologies collectively aim to create even more lasting and economical cooling and heating systems, replying to the raising demand for energy-efficient remedies in modern buildings.
Lasting Cooling Agent Solutions
Which sustainable refrigerant options are leading the method for a greener future in cooling and heating technology? The sector is progressively changing in the direction of low-global warming potential (GWP) cooling agents, such as hydrofluoroolefins (HFOs) and natural refrigerants like ammonia, co2, and hydrocarbons. These alternatives not just minimize environmental influence but likewise enhance energy effectiveness in cooling down systems. HFOs, for example, provide effective cooling performance while reducing ozone exhaustion and greenhouse gas exhausts. Additionally, developments in cooling agent management and recycling technologies are further promoting sustainability. As guidelines tighten globally, the adoption of these green cooling agents is ending up being vital for consumers and suppliers alike. Eventually, embracing sustainable cooling agent options is necessary for the future of a/c systems in producing ecologically responsible buildings.
